Cadence Goes All-In on Digital Twins, Drug Discovery, Information Centres

Digital twin expertise is hovering in its use circumstances in the mean time. Cadence Design Programs, a long-standing heavyweight in computational software program, is increasing its digital twin expertise past semiconductors.

Whereas Cadence has lengthy been recognized for its work in EDA (digital design automation), the corporate is now utilizing its computational horsepower to simulate programs that vary from drug molecules to city visitors patterns.

In an interview with AIM, Jayashankar Narayanankutty, the group director at Cadence, mentioned the corporate’s increasing digital twin technique and its implications throughout sectors.

“At Cadence, we didn’t set out to do that—however over time, our capability to simulate billions of nodes concurrently developed into one thing much more highly effective,” Narayanankutty mentioned. “That’s what led us into digital twins, and the outcomes have been nothing in need of groundbreaking.”

Reimagining Drug Discovery

Maybe Cadence’s most surprising software of digital twins is organic simulation. Utilizing its AI-powered Orion platform, the corporate can now simulate how medication are delivered to organic cells, a problem historically tackled by way of costly and time-consuming discipline trials.

“Now we have all the time been about computational software program,” Narayanankutty explains. “We all know how you can do the maths. We simulate billions of nodes and now are utilizing that to mannequin the perfect medium for delivering medication to organic cells.”

He elaborated that this sort of simulation historically takes a very long time. Nonetheless, by integrating AI with computational functionality, the corporate “can simulate eventualities which can be humanly inconceivable to duplicate by way of discipline assessments”.

Area assessments are normally restricted by time, value, and the variety of individuals, however AI permits overcoming these limitations. He additionally notes the corporate’s shift from being a code-based computational software program firm to working in a web-based AI setting.

Digital Twins Inside Information Centres

“Right this moment, almost 20% of the world’s power is consumed by knowledge centres,” Narayanankutty famous. One among Cadence’s digital twins’ most tangible use circumstances is AI-driven knowledge centre design.

The corporate’s Actuality DC platform simulates knowledge centre operations to dynamically optimise cooling and power utilization, two of probably the most essential value elements in trendy computing.

“We assist design knowledge centres particular to the mannequin,” Narayanankutty mentioned. “Then we simulate them in actual time so power consumption decreases.”

Conventional knowledge centres apply uniform cooling, which ends up in inefficiencies like increased warmth in sure racks, decreasing efficiency, whereas overcooling in much less lively areas wastes power.

“With Actuality DC, we dynamically redirect assets to the place they’re wanted, reducing power use by as much as 30%.”

NVIDIA itself makes use of Cadence Actuality to optimise its AI factories. Huang famous, “Omniverse Blueprint connects with Cadence’s Actuality Digital Twin Platform to design and function AI factories.”

This partnership is already paying dividends, with firms like Schneider Electrical deploying these simulations to extend energy block effectivity and reliability in actual time.
